functionlessadj.

Brit. /ˈfʌŋ(k)ʃnləs/, U.S. /ˈfəŋ(k)ʃənləs/
Origin: Formed within English, by derivation. Etymons: function n., -less suffix.
Etymology: < function n. + -less suffix.
Having no function; without a function.

1819 Eclectic Repertory & Analyt. Rev. 9 480 When one organ is functionless, another organ will become capable of increased action.
1836 A. W. Fonblanque Eng. under Seven Admin. (1837) III. 296 Its nominal functionless minister.
1879 A. W. Bennett in Academy 32 A fifth stamen, which however is functionless, so far as the ordinary purpose of stamens is concerned.
1920 Biol. Bull. 39 137 [The bacteria]..take possession of the adipocytes and render them functionless as fat cells.
1958 S. Plath Jrnl. 2 Mar. (2000) 342 Their uncomfortable second-floor flat, chairs turned wrong-side-to, records scattered, white marble fireplace angular & functionless.
2006 Science 24 Mar. 1730/1 Mutational and population-level processes that operate to increase amounts of functionless DNA.
